Smita S. Joshi is a scholar working on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, Dermatology and Oncology. According to data from OpenAlex, Smita S. Joshi has authored 22 papers receiving a total of 1.7k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 8 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, 6 papers in Dermatology and 5 papers in Oncology. Recurrent topics in Smita S. Joshi's work include Gastric Cancer Management and Outcomes (5 papers), Cutaneous lymphoproliferative disorders research (3 papers) and Gastrointestinal Tumor Research and Treatment (3 papers). Smita S. Joshi is often cited by papers focused on Gastric Cancer Management and Outcomes (5 papers), Cutaneous lymphoproliferative disorders research (3 papers) and Gastrointestinal Tumor Research and Treatment (3 papers). Smita S. Joshi collaborates with scholars based in United States, South Korea and Nepal. Smita S. Joshi's co-authors include Brian D. Badgwell, Alan R. Shalita, Whitney P. Bowe, Daniel V.T. Catenacci, Steven B. Maron, Dennis P. West, Alfred Rademaker, Sara Ortiz-Toquero, Mario E. Lacouture and Sara Rosenbaum and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Clinical Oncology, Blood and Cancer.
